Method
Preparation
-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C) and line a muffin tin with paper liners.
- In a b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, whole wheat fl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t.
- In another bowl, combine the milk, vegetable oil, egg, and vanilla extract. Mix until well combined.
- Gradually add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ients and stir until just combined. Gently fold in the mixed berries.
- In a separate bowl, beat the cream cheese and powdered sugar together until smooth.
Assembly
- Fill each muffin liner halfway with the batter, add a dollop of the cream cheese mixture, then top with more batter until the liners are about 2/3 full.
- Sprinkle the buttery crumble topping over each muffin.
Baking
- Bake for 18-20 minutes or until a toothpick inserted comes out clean.
- For the glaze, whisk the powdered sugar with milk and vanilla extract until smooth.
- Allow muffins to cool slightly before drizzling with glaze. Serve warm.
Notes
Store the muffins in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days. For longer storage, keep them in the fridge for up to a week or freeze for up to 3 months. Reheat in the microwave for a warm treat.
